"Phoenix ashes" you whispered to the Sapient Gargoyle, stepping aside it reveals the spiral staircase.

Climbing the steps up to the door, you knock in hope that Snape would answer.

"Enter!" He bellows.

You open the door, stepping into the circular room. Snape was sat at the claw-footed desk, seemingly concentrating on something.

"I said 8, Miss White. You're early." He said, not even looking at you.

"Better than being late I guess..." you say stepping further inside, you notice Snape was fiddling with something. It appeared to be a gold ring with a black stone, you assumed it was Onyx. "I didn't know you wore jewellery Sir." You smirk. it would of actually suited him, but you knew it wasn't really his...At least, you had never seen him with it before.

Snape exhaled audibly. "Very funny." He said, placing the ring inside the desk drawer. "This ring holds great importance."

"Well...who's the lucky girl?" You ask, before you really thought about what actually came out of your mouth. You choked on your words, Snape raised his eyebrows at you. "I wasn't kidding Sir, for all I know you could already be married!"

"I am...not." He spoke with hostility. "Now is not the time to discuss our personal lives, White." He got up from the desk at the exact moment he said your name which made you jump. Your heart started to beat faster as he walked around the desk and stopped directly in front of you. His towering height over you was apparent.

"This ring is the cause of the fatal curse that resides within the headmaster." Snape says, his face showing the seriousness of the matter.

"That's why he's dying? But..how? How could a ring kill someone? Was it bewitched?" You say, bombarding Snape with questions.

"The ring was a horcrux. I expect you don't know what that-"

"It's an object that someone has hidden a fragment of their soul into, in order to become..."

"Immortal, yes." Snape appeared to be quite shocked as he finished your sentence. "But how did you-"

"Magick Moste Evile, Sir. The Malfoy's had a copy of it in their library, me and Draco used to sneak in there to see if we could set off one of the screaming books." You chuckle. "I guess I just sort of...accidentally discovered it. I'm sure it's probably not reading material for a child, I was only 10." You say, feeling a little pang in your heart as you mention Draco. You couldn't help but miss talking to him. Now, he wouldn't talk to you. Your mind then shifted- "Hang on...to create a horcrux, one must kill..." you say. Whoever does such a thing must be an incredibly evil person, you thought.

"Well...I can imagine you can take a guess at who would do such a thing." Snape says, once again raising one of his eyebrows to muster a quick response.

You knew immediately who would do something as terrible as that. Voldemort.

Snape nodded, having obviously just read your mind.

"Professor Dumbledore attempted to destroy it you see, the Horcrux however was protected, It cursed him."

You nodded back, understanding him. It explained Dumbledore's black, withered-looking hand.

"I've managed to stop the curse from spreading any further, alas it is inevitable that it will kill him...eventually." Snape said, swallowing any emotion. "Have you wondered recently why your hair seems to be changing colour?" His eyes focus on the silvery white strands of hair that are tucked behind your ears.

"It's just stress." You say, not believing your own assumption.

"Your hair started changing the exact same time that Professor Dumbledore was cursed." Snape started to pace in front of you, his mind whirring. "It's like...something inside of you is connected. Connected to this ring." Snape stops in his tracks, as if he just had a light bulb moment. "I wonder..." He says before heading back over to the desk, he opens up the drawer again and takes out the ring. Bringing it towards you. You glanced at it, immediately your heart sank.

"W-where did you get this?" You manage to choke out. Your eyes started to fill with tears. "This was my mother's." Now seeing it up close this was definitely the ring your mother once had. You remember it so well, she wore it only on special occasions, those special occasions being when she went to the Malfoy meetings. To which you now know were death eater meetings. The rest of the time she wasn't wearing it, it sat in her jewellery box collecting dust.

Funny...When she died you never saw it again.

"Miss White. I think The dark lord gave this ring to your mother. I think she had the duty to protect it. That's why you never saw it again after she died, the dark lord must have taken it back from her and then re-hidden it, however he didn't hide it very well because the headmaster managed to retrieve it."

You stood still, taking everything in. Seeing that ring again made it painful to hold back your emotions, your throat felt as though you had swallowed a razor blade.

"I think you are the only one who is able to destroy it. Your mother must have died whilst wearing it, her blood is imbued inside it. I just know it. You share the same blood therefore you are the only one who can truly break inside of it." Snape ranted, he clenched the ring in his hand still as he started pacing once again.

It made sense, being orphaned you were the last of your bloodline. If your mothers blood really was inside of that ring, it must make some sort of connection to you.

You managed to pluck up some courage, your throat relaxing, the tears no longer filling your eyes.

"If this is going to help bring that monster down, I'm in." You said, trying to uphold your bravery.

Suddenly you felt the pocket of your robe move, much like when Snape placed the note inside of it in the great hall, but this time it felt much heavier. You peered down to see a gleaming silver sword, the top of the handle was encrusted with glittering rubies. Snape stared at it, stunned. You pulled it out of your pocket carefully, trying not to slice through your robe. You knew what you had to do, and boy were you ready.

Snape opened his hand up, offering the ring to you. You took it from him, your fingers brushing against the palm of his hand. You felt your stomach begin to fill with butterflies, you couldn't tell if it was because of the physical contact with him or the fact that you were about to destroy a freakin' Horcrux.

"This is for you, mum." You say, placing the ring onto Dumbledore's desk. You held the sword of Gryffindor in your hands tightly, raising it above your head. For all you knew, destroying the ring could kill you, however at this moment in time you couldn't care less. If this was going to aid in bringing the most evil, dark wizard down, you were prepared to risk your life to do so.

Snape stood close beside you, giving you an encouraging nod.

"Here's to mortality!" You shout, swinging the sword back and smashing it down onto the ring, the room filled with black smoke and an ear piercing scream came out of the ring, to which you recognised as your mother's. The Horcrux span in a circle, your body felt as if it was being electrocuted by a giant taser. You doubled over, your teeth clenched, groaning in pain.

Then the ring stopped.

The smoke-filled room cleared, enough for you to regain balance and see your surroundings again.

You stood up, dropping the sword onto the ground. The metal clattered against the stone floor as you looked up at Snape, your eyes locked together, both of you breathing heavily. You dove in to embrace him, your head resting tightly against his moving chest, arms wrapped around his neck. To your surprise he returned the embrace, wrapping his arms around you tightly. You wanted to stay there forever, in that moment, frozen in time.

"Headmaster!" Snape exclaimed, letting you go and pushing you off of him. Your eyes widened, at the door stood Dumbledore, a wide smile plastered on his face.
